  • The three most commonly used Steel materials in mechanical design-SUS304, C45 and Q235

    The three most commonly used Steel materials in mechanical design-SUS304, C45 and Q235

    The origin of the name of these materials,304 is just a code for stainless steel, and has no special meaning,304 generally represents ASTM standard production, and SUS 304 represents Japanese standard production; the reason why C45 steel is called 45 is because its carbon content is 0.45%, so it is named 45 steel; The "Q" in Q235 represents the yield strength of the material.
